引言
随着人工智能技术的飞速发展,AI渲染技术在影视制作、游戏开发、虚拟现实等领域展现出巨大的潜力。本文将深入解析AI渲染技术的原理、应用以及如何轻松上手,帮助读者打造逼真的视觉效果。
一、AI渲染技术概述
1.1 什么是AI渲染?
AI渲染是指利用人工智能算法,如深度学习、神经网络等,对图像进行渲染处理的技术。它通过分析大量数据,自动优化渲染过程,提高渲染质量和效率。
1.2 AI渲染的优势
- 提高渲染速度:AI渲染可以自动优化渲染流程,减少渲染时间。
- 提升渲染质量:AI渲染能够自动调整光线、色彩等参数,使渲染效果更加逼真。
- 降低硬件要求:AI渲染可以降低对硬件性能的要求,使更多设备能够实现高质量渲染。
二、AI渲染技术原理
2.1 深度学习
深度学习是AI渲染的核心技术之一。它通过模拟人脑神经元结构,对大量数据进行学习,从而实现图像渲染。
2.2 神经网络
神经网络是深度学习的基础,它由多个神经元组成,通过前向传播和反向传播算法进行训练。
2.3 生成对抗网络(GAN)
生成对抗网络是一种特殊的神经网络,由生成器和判别器组成。生成器负责生成图像,判别器负责判断图像的真实性。两者相互竞争,不断提高生成图像的质量。
三、AI渲染应用案例
3.1 影视制作
AI渲染技术在影视制作中发挥着重要作用。例如,在电影《阿凡达》中,AI渲染技术实现了逼真的潘多拉星球场景。
3.2 游戏开发
AI渲染技术在游戏开发中应用广泛。例如,游戏《荒野大镖客救赎2》采用了AI渲染技术,实现了细腻的视觉效果。
3.3 虚拟现实
AI渲染技术在虚拟现实领域具有巨大潜力。例如,通过AI渲染技术,可以实现更加逼真的虚拟现实场景。
四、如何轻松上手AI渲染
4.1 学习基础知识
首先,需要了解AI渲染的基本原理,包括深度学习、神经网络等。
4.2 选择合适的工具
目前,市面上有许多AI渲染工具,如Unity、Unreal Engine等。选择一款适合自己的工具,并进行深入学习。
4.3 实践操作
通过实际操作,掌握AI渲染的基本技巧。可以从简单的场景开始,逐步提高难度。
4.4 参加培训课程
参加专业的AI渲染培训课程,系统学习相关知识,提高自己的技能水平。
五、总结
AI渲染技术为打造逼真的视觉效果提供了强大的支持。通过本文的介绍,相信读者对AI渲染技术有了更深入的了解。希望本文能帮助读者轻松上手AI渲染,创作出令人惊叹的视觉效果。
